We’re thrilled to announce a partnership that’s been almost two decades in the making. Chris Clemons, with an impressive 30 career PDGA wins and currently ranked #23 in the United States Tour, is joining Team Discraft’s Tour Team!

Chris’ disc golf journey began almost 20 years ago, throwing a variety of Discraft discs. Now in 2024, this marks a full-circle moment as he returns to his roots! But this partnership isn’t just about nostalgia; it’s about the future. Chris is more motivated than ever to compete alongside the best on Team Discraft, striving for greatness and pushing the boundaries of the sport.

As Chris Clemons embarks on this exciting chapter, he can’t wait to explore the new molds that have been released since his last Discraft days. Encouraging all his fans to follow along with him, you’ll be experiencing the thrill of discovering these discs together! Beyond his playing years, Chris has big plans for the world of disc golf. With this new partnership, together, we’ll shape the future of disc golf, creating something truly special.
